Is this graphing? If so, remember the formula: y=mx+b
If it's y=-1/3x+1, then 1 is your slope intercept
Place the dot on your graph where 1 is on your y-intercept.
Graphing -1/3x is just like rise over run, positives go up then right, (If 1/3 was graphed you would go 1 pixel up then 3 to the right.)
Since -1/3x is a negative, you're going down 1, left 3. It should give you a line that is coming from the top of the graphing box to the bottom.
If you want, create a table for x and y. If 0 was your x, then your y is 1, this is because theres a +1 in your equation.
If 3 was your x, then your y would be 0, because -1/3(3) + 1 is 0.
